From curious to champion, if you are interested in the sport of archery, we can help you "take aim".  We offer opportunities to learn and shoot as you feel comfortable.  Shoot on your own, learn from our mentors or even decide to shoot competitively - the choice is yours.  All Club memberships include the full use of all Club provided equipment for as long as needed as well as a two hour safety and orientation training session to get you out on the range quickly.  Look for our Club "Open Houses" to give it a try.  Only current residents of the On Top of the World community holding a current Resident ID Card or Gateway of Services Pass may join the Club. 

 

Forms required to join the Club, including the application and the two required waivers (OTOW and Sadler Sports Insurance), are detailed below and available for download.  Every new Club member must pre-register and attend a 2 hour "Safety and Orientation Training" session before being allowed on the Range.

Insurance

Every Club member, regardless of membership type, upon payment of the appropriate Club dues/fees, signing the insurance waiver and taking the required Safety Training class, is covered by a $1,000,000 liability insurance policy and a $50,000 accident insurance policy through Sadler Sports Insurance and our NFAA affiliation.  The liability policy is primary coverage, while the accident policy is secondary coverage to your own health insurance policy.  

Safety Training

Every new Club member, regardless of membership type, must take our Safety & Orientation Training class, which includes limited initial shooting instruction.  These sessions are offered at the Range on Wednesday mornings, as scheduled on the Club calendar.  If you can't make a Wednesday morning session, we will try to accommodate your scheduling requirments.  Pre-registration through one of the Club contacts below is always required.
